Output 17bf84a4681260f64ba69b1fa73add773a7c061da61d3a8d0373cc6cea60f200:1

value
759740000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50be5bd09af05ddd84611703a5fb4522c8481cef OP_EQUALVERIFY OP_CHECKSIG
address
DCW2dxPpFVaoTY7qAhxmkCAfoFYswC42Lt
transaction
17bf84a4681260f64ba69b1fa73add773a7c061da61d3a8d0373cc6cea60f200